2 Deployment Environment

This section provides information about the cloud native infrastructure used for Oracle Communications Cloud Native Core, Network Repository Function (NRF) benchmarking.

2.1 Deployed Components

This section provides details about the deployed components.

2.1.1 Hardware Details

This section describes the hardware details.

Table 2-1 Hardware Details

Nodes Type
Master Nodes ORACLE SERVER X8-2
Top of Rack Switch Cisco 93108TC-EX
Worker Nodes ORACLE SERVER X8-2

2.1.2 System Software

This section describes the system software details.

Table 2-2 System Software

System Software Details
Operating System (+Kernel Version)

5.15.0-105.125.6.2.2.el8uek.x86_64

Oracle Linux Server 8.8

Hypervisor BareMetal Server
CNE 23.4.1
OSO NA
Kubernetes 1.27.x
ASM 1.21.6
cnDBTier 25.2.200

2.1.3 Observability Services

This section describes the observability services used for NRF benchmarking.

Table 2-3 Observability Services

Service Name Version
Fluentd OpenSearch 1.16.2
Grafana 9.5.3
Jaeger 1.52.0
Kyverno 1.9.0
MetalLB 0.14.4
OpenSearch 2.11.0
OpenSearch Dashboard 2.11.0
Prometheus 2.51.1

2.1.4 CNE Common Services

The following are the CNE common services observed in the deployment:
  • alertmanager-occne-kube-prom-stack-kube-alertmanager
  • occne-alertmanager-snmp-notifier
  • occne-bastion-controller
  • occne-fluentd
  • occne-kube-prom-stack-grafana
  • occne-kube-prom-stack-kube-operator
  • occne-kube-prom-stack-kube-state-metrics
  • occne-kube-prom-stack-prometheus-node
  • occne-metallb
  • occne-metallb-controller
  • occne-metrics-server
  • occne-opensearch-cluster-client
  • occne-opensearch-cluster-master
  • occne-opensearch-dashboards
  • occne-promxy
  • occne-promxy-apigw-nginx
  • occne-tracer-jaeger
  • occne-tracer-jaeger-collector
  • occne-tracer-jaeger-query
  • prometheus-occne-kube-prom-stack-kube-prometheus